Work by these groups is built around the idea of how to effectively manage sizable hiring and retention costs.

That cost management looks at the TOTAL cost of the transaction(s) recognizing important factors. Typically, an employer can self-ask this question: “If we use this recruiter (agency or career manager) can we expect better net results than if we did all the work ourselves?” If the answer is yes, an employer will use that outside recruiter or agency.

If you use a career manager, you may have out of pocket expense. However, you will almost certainly find a desirable job quicker than you would by job hunting on your own. Plus, willing employers will recognize they are saving a recruiter fee. Business is a contact sport. The career manager is much like the agent for a professional athlete. They know the market and they do have contacts. The very personal question then becomes this: How much does it cost you to be unemployed – every hour – every day, week or month?
